Common Name: Elephant's ear plant
Genus: Alocasia
Species: x amazonica
Skill Level: Experienced
Exposure: Partial shade
Hardiness: Tender
Soil type: Well-drained/light, Moist
Height: 65cm
Time to divide plants: March to May
Alocasias are found in tropical Asia and are grown for their large, heavily veined leaves. Most varieties need a warm greenhouse and high humidity during the growing season to flourish, but some, such as A. amazonica, make interesting houseplants. This variety has very dark green, glossy leaves with a contrasting white veins and margins and has been given an Award of Garden Merit (AGM), which is for plants of outstanding excellence. Grow in an equal mix of composted bark, loam and sand in filtered light.
